Chocolate Coconut Cream Cake
Ingredients
- 1 can (290 ml) sweetened coconut cream
- 4 large eggs
- 4 oz dark chocolate, melted
- 1 cup sweetened shredded coconut
- 1/2 cup all-purpose flour
- 1 tsp vanilla extract
- 1/4 tsp ground cinnamon
Instructions
- Preheat the oven to 350°F. Lightly grease an 8×8 baking dish. Set aside.
- In a medium bowl, mix together all of the ingredients until fully combined.
- Pour the batter into the prepared baking dish. Bake in the preheated oven for 30-40 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ted comes out clean.
Notes
- Best served with ice cream on top.
- Store in an airtight container for up to 5 days.

Your cake sounds delicious. Sorry about the ants. If they are sugar ants (real tiny things) buy a little bottle of bait for sugar ants and put a drop where you see the ants. Hundreds will come (resist killing them then) and take the poison back to their nest. They will all die.
